Mohammad Khaled appointed new ACC secretary

Mohammad Khaled Rahim, Additional Secretary at the Cabinet Division, has been appointed as the new Secretary of the Anti-Corruption Commission (ACC).


The Ministry of Public Administration issued a notification on Wednesday (July 16), assigning him to the post following his promotion to the rank of Secretary.

Earlier, on June 24, ACC Secretary Khorsheda Yasmeen was made an officer on special duty (OSD) to facilitate her transition into post-retirement leave (PRL), reports UNB.
